Steps to Design a Warehouse Inventory Template
Creating a comprehensive warehouse inventory template is crucial for enhancing operational efficiency and accuracy in managing stock levels. In 2025, best practices focus on automation, real-time data, and data-driven decision-making. Here's a step-by-step guide to designing an effective warehouse inventory template.
1. Minimize Manual Input with Automation
Manual data entry is time-consuming and prone to errors. To mitigate these issues, design your inventory template to be compatible with automated data capture technologies such as RFID, barcode scanning, and IoT sensors. According to a report by Logistics Management, companies using RFID technology see a 10-20% increase in inventory accuracy. By integrating these technologies, you can streamline data entry processes, enhance accuracy, and free up staff for more value-added tasks.
2. Implement Real-Time Inventory Tracking
Incorporating real-time inventory tracking is essential for maintaining accurate stock levels and optimizing warehouse operations. Design your template to work with a perpetual inventory system integrated with a Warehouse Management System (WMS). This enables live data feeds, reflecting changes in inventory due to receiving, picking, shipping, or restocking instantly. For example, Amazon’s warehouses are known for their use of real-time tracking systems, contributing to their efficient inventory management and rapid order fulfillment.
3. Incorporate Cycle Counting and ABC Analysis
Regular inventory audits are vital, but full physical counts can disrupt operations. Instead, incorporate cycle counting into your template—a method that involves counting portions of inventory on a rotating schedule. Pair this with ABC analysis, which categorizes inventory into tiers based on importance, focusing more frequent counts on high-value items. This approach maintains inventory accuracy without significant operational disruptions and helps prioritize resources effectively.
4. Utilize Data-Driven Planning
Leverage historical data and predictive analytics to drive inventory decisions. Your template should include fields that capture key performance metrics (KPIs) and generate reports that inform forecasting and demand planning. A study by McKinsey found that data-driven supply chain management can lead to a 15% reduction in inventory levels while still meeting customer demands. Incorporate dashboards and visual tools to make the data accessible and actionable.
5. Optimize Layout Visualization
An effective inventory template should offer a clear visualization of warehouse layout and stock locations. This feature aids in optimizing storage space and improving picking efficiency. Include schematic diagrams or digital maps that highlight item locations and movement paths. For instance, using heatmaps to visualize high-frequency routes can lead to better aisle layouts, reducing travel time and boosting picker productivity.
6. Manage Batch, Lot, and Expiry
For industries dealing with perishable goods or batch-controlled items, it's crucial to track batches, lots, and expiry dates accurately. Your inventory template should include fields for recording batch numbers, lot numbers, and expiry dates. This ensures compliance with industry regulations and minimizes waste. An example is the pharmaceutical industry, where accurate tracking is not just a matter of efficiency but also of safety and compliance.
